TRIP DETAILS

Experience an extraordinary journey through the Balkans as you cycle from the vibrant city of Sarajevo to the shimmering Adriatic and the UNESCO-listed treasure of Dubrovnik.

Begin in Sarajevo, where East meets West in a fascinating blend of Ottoman and Austro-Hungarian heritage, then ride along the historic Ciro Trail, a restored cycling route built on the old narrow-gauge railway that once connected Sarajevo with the Dalmatian Coast. This iconic trail leads you through the rolling landscapes of Herzegovina and the dramatic Dinaric Alps. Follow peaceful backroads and trails to Mostar, pausing to admire its graceful Stari Most bridge. From Mostar continue through the lush Neretva Valley, an area popular for winegrowing. The converted railway trails go alongside the tranquil wetlands of Hutovo Blato Nature Park, a haven for many species of migratory birds before taking you close to the border with Croatia. Your ride concludes in Trebinje, on the Trebišnjica River, where you can visit the compact walled old town. End in Dubrovnik, where sunlit stone walls and sparkling sea vistas crown this captivating journey through culture, nature and timeless beauty. Your journey will take you through centuries of history, from medieval tombstones scattered alongside the road, to the formation of the cities of Sarajevo and Mostar during the Ottoman Empire to the more recent history of the 1990's and the break up of the Balkans. The people you will meet along the way will also give you a great insight into this fascinating region.

TERRAIN

This route follows a combination of quiet country roads, gravel tracks and busier roads as you enter and depart each overnight stop. The routes are quite challenging in terms of terrain, elevation and distance. Parts of the routes on the Ciro Trail take you through tunnels, some of which are inhabited by bats. E-bikes are included as standard.

Day 1: Arrive in Sarajevo

Arrive in Sarajevo and head out to explore the Latin bridge, site of the assassination of Archduke Franz Ferdinand's triggering World War I.

Day 2: Sarajevo to Bjelasnica

Spend the morning exploring Baščaršija, the old bazaar and historical centre of Sarajevo. For history enthusiasts there are a multitude of museums giving an insight into the 1990's war. In the afternoon collect your e-bike and transfer to the mountain ski resort of Bjelašnica where the alpine events of the 1984 Olympics were held.

Day 3: Bjelasnica to Boracko Jezero (63km/39.1mi)

Your first day on the bike takes you over the Bjelašnica and Visočica mountain ranges to Boračko lake. This route follows the 'Caravan' trading route once used during the Ottoman era. You'll pass medieval tombstones, by the side of the road, monuments of Bosnia's medieval history. The final stretch of the day takes you alongside the River Neretva towards the lake.

Day 4: Boracko Jezero to Mostar (56km/34.8mi)

Start the day with a climb out of Boračko Lake with switchbacks to a view back down to the lake. A spectacular ride across the Prenj mountain range, the side of the Bosnian Himalayas follows. Continue through small villages to Mostar, best known for its iconic Stari Most bridge. Explore the narrow streets of the Old City, lined with historic Ottoman-era buildings.

Day 5: Mostar to Capljina (46km/28.6mi)

Today you will follow the Ciro Trail, a route that follows the path of an old, abandoned narrow-gauge railway line. Cycle through the vineyards of Herzegovina and visit Blagaj Tekija, a 16th-century Sufi Dervish monastery built into a cliff face at the source of the Buna River. Continue along the beautiful valley of the Neretva river to Capljina.

Day 6: Capljina to Ravno (55km/34.2mi)

Continue to follow the Ciro Trail along the edge of Hutovo Blato, a magnificent nature reserve where more than 250 different kinds of migratory birds can be found during the year. There are many observation points along the way, passing through the old railway stations of Roman Villa Rustica, Brstanica and Ravno.

Hotel Stanica Ravno, once a railway station building on the Vienna to Dubrovnik line has since been transformed into a boutique hotel with comfortable rooms, pool and restaurant. In the basement (and former prison) you will now find a wine bar.

Day 7: Ravno to Trebinje (Dubrovnik) (52km/32.3mi)

Your first stop today is Zavala, where you can visit one of the biggest speleological sights in Bosnia and Herzegovina, the Vjetrenica Cave. Your ride takes you along the Popovo fields an area that flooded regularly in the past, leaidng to most of the old villages being located on the sides of the dry limestone mountains and ridges. Continue to cycle along old train tracks repurposed as village roads to the charming little town of Trebinje. Explore the old town before a transfer takes you to the Adriatic coast and an overnight stay in Dubrovnik.
